PROBLEM 1
I'm selecting a file on the desktop.
I'm moving it to an open nautilus window.
The cursor takes the form of a hand.
The file is not moved.
The cursor retains its hand shape.
Nautilus remains usable.
Firefox is no longer usable (the cursor is no longer present).
PROBLEM 2
Similar actions, alternative results.
The file move behind the Nautilus windows, staying on desktop, but at a
different location.
Solution for unlocking problem 1:
use gnome-tweak, desktop parameters
deactivate icon on desktop.
reactivate icon on desktop.
Problem solved
Behavioral solution:
Use the Nautilus tree structure to move files from the desktop to other folders.
